The heliosphere extends past the orbit on the planets within our solar technique. As a result, Earth exists inside the Sunshine’s environment. Outside the heliosphere is interstellar Room.

A solar technique refers into a star and every one of the objects that orbit it. Our Solar technique is made of the Sunlight — our household star —, 8 planets and their pure satellites (for instance our moon), dwarf planets, asteroids and comets. It is located within an outward spiral arm from the Milky Way galaxy.

the main try to describe the shape with the Milky Way and also the placement of your Sunshine inside of it was carried out by William Herschel in 1785 by thoroughly counting the number of stars in numerous locations of the obvious sky. He developed website a diagram of The form of your Milky Way Using the Solar technique near the center.[80]

In Greek mythology, Zeus spots his son born by a mortal woman, the infant Heracles, on Hera's breast when she's asleep so the infant will drink her divine milk and turn out to be immortal. Hera wakes up when breastfeeding after which you can realizes she's nursing an mysterious child: she pushes the baby away, several of her milk spills, and it produces the band of light generally known as the Milky Way.

Observe, even though, there are two oddballs in our solar system that do not rotate in a similar way as the remainder of the planets. Uranus rotates about an axis that is sort of parallel with its orbital airplane (i.e. on its facet), even though Venus rotates about its axis in the clockwise route. These oddities are regarded as because of activities, for instance collisions, which occurred over the development of the solar method.

The disk of stars within the Milky Way doesn't have a sharp edge outside of which there won't be any stars. instead, the concentration of stars decreases with length from the middle from the Milky Way. past a radius of around 40,000 gentle a long time (thirteen kpc) from the center, the amount of stars for each cubic parsec drops much faster with radius.[113] bordering the galactic disk is really a spherical galactic halo of stars and globular clusters that extends farther outward, but is restricted in dimensions with the orbits of two Milky Way satellites, the massive and modest Magellanic Clouds, whose closest method of the Galactic Center is about one hundred eighty,000 ly (55 kpc).
